Transaction 7391a7b964f463269f7ec4872745a19ceaa1b918c9d23a538980694d65a126fd
1 Input
1 Output
-
7391a7b964f463269f7ec4872745a19ceaa1b918c9d23a538980694d65a126fd:0
- value
- 17221458
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 edcb0d97842b5fa85268ca73a4169f9f5adf1ce7 OP_EQUAL
- address
- 3PNMKPDQgohqjVephJX4rmoZEDKmAFh4Li